Find the total value of the investment after the time given: $36,000 at 13.7% compounded semiannually for 2 years

A = P ( 1 + r/n ) ^ nt

P is the principle which is 36000

r is the rate which is 13.7 % or .137 in decimal form

n is the number of time per year, semi annual means 2 times per year

t is the time = 2

A = 36000( 1 + .137/2) ^ (2*2)

36000( 1 + .137/2) ^ (4)
